Is the Yeti (Big Foot) real?

This idea comes with several names--Yeti, Abominable Snowman, Big Foot, Sasquatch or whatever. This creature is basically an ape-like species that’s fur covered and is larger than a normal human. Traditionally, such a species is considered to be legend.

Lieutenant-Colonel Charles Howard-Bury first used the term ‘Abominable Snowman’ when he climbed Mount Everest in 1921 and found footprints that he believed were made by such a creature, and as you could imagine, the media made this idea a fabulous tabloid story. Yeti is a Napali word and it is part of Himalayan culture.

Bigfoot is also called Sasquatch and again it’s a purported ape-like species living in forests mostly in the Pacific Northwest; although there have been thousands of bigfoot sightings all over the place. Actually, this is not a new idea. Indigenous American Indian tribes have related stories about these creatures long before they became a popular media concept.

Fuzzy images of Bigfoot have shown up in tabloids, and shaky movies have been made of them, usually at a distance that makes it hard to see the creature’s features. Most of these have been dismissed as fakes.

So, what are people seeing out there in the woods? That’s a good question that’s almost as hard to answer as what are all of the UFO sightings. Some claim it’s a guy running around in a suit. Others claim it’s a Gigantopithecus. Say what? This is a hypothesis that’s considered questionable. Supposedly Gigantopithecus fossils have been found in the Americas, but they consist of only mandibles and teeth. The argument against this idea is that the creature would be too large to adopt a bipedal gate. In other words, it’s too big to walk like a man. Isn’t that a song?

Another proposal is that they are an extinct Paranthopus, but fossils of this creature were only found in Africa. Then there is the idea that it is a Neanderthal. Again no remains have been found in the Americas. The main problem is that no ancient species could have survived into modern times. The lack of credible evidence and legitimate recording casts doubts on the existence of these ape-like monsters.
